In 2022, Transit Warehouses And Services Bulgaria implemented Composity BI. The deployment aligns the Composity Business Software footprint that powers the public website with Composity BI as the Analytics and BI application, the site footer noted as Powered by Composity Business Software indicates use of Composity CMS and eCommerce modules alongside reporting capabilities. Composity BI supports reporting across sales, inventory movement, and core operations for this 25 employee distribution firm in Bulgaria. Implementation architecture ties the CMS-driven public storefront to back-office operational workflows and Composity BI reporting modules, establishing a single-platform approach to content, commerce, and analytics. Functional modules observed include Composity eCommerce and CMS for the public site, and Composity BI reporting and analytics modules for transactional and operational visibility, with data orchestration handled within the Composity environment. Governance and operational scope center on centralizing site content management and operational reporting within Composity to streamline administrative and operational workflows for the companys Bulgarian operations.

In 2017, Undp deployed Composity BI to support the Sustainable Procurement in the Health Sector Secretariat, focused on global knowledge-sharing and program reporting. Composity developers were engaged to build and extend an integrated website/CMS, CRM, document management system and an Online Engagement Tool that anchored content, engagement and document workflows. The Composity BI implementation delivered Analytics and BI functionality including segmented reporting and Online Engagement Tool reports, inferred from the project scope and the UNDP tender documentation. Work included configuration of reporting modules, data aggregation and dashboarding consistent with Analytics and BI platforms, with Composity developers extending application logic during Phase 2 and Phase 3 work described in the tender notice. Operational coverage centered on the SPHS Secretariat and global program reporting, with the Composity BI instance linked to the integrated website/CMS, CRM and document management repositories to provide consolidated reporting feeds. Governance followed phased development cycles and developer-led extensions to adapt reporting and online engagement workflows for segmented reporting and OET outputs.
